Complete Guide to Home Loan Pre-approval in Australia

Understanding the pre-approval process can strengthen your position when buying a home and help determine your borrowing capacity.

Hero Image for Complete Guide to Home Loan Pre-approval in Australia

Getting pre-approved for a home loan is one of the most important steps in your property purchasing journey. Pre-approval provides you with a clear understanding of your borrowing capacity and demonstrates to vendors that you're a serious buyer with confirmed financing.

What is Home Loan Pre-approval?

Home loan pre-approval is a conditional approval from a lender that confirms how much you can borrow before you start shopping for a property. During this process, lenders assess your financial situation, including your income, expenses, assets, and liabilities to determine your loan amount and suitable home loan options.

Pre-approval typically remains valid for three to six months, giving you time to find the right property within your budget. This preliminary approval helps streamline the application process once you've found your ideal home.

Benefits of Getting Pre-approved

Securing pre-approval offers several advantages when buying a home:

Clear budget parameters - Know exactly what loan amount you qualify for
Stronger negotiating position - Vendors take your offers more seriously
Faster settlement - The application process moves more quickly
Interest rate protection - Some lenders offer rate holds during pre-approval periods
Access to home loan options - Compare products from banks and lenders across Australia

Documents Required for Pre-approval

Lenders require comprehensive documentation to assess your application. Prepare these essential documents:

• Recent payslips (usually last two months)
• Bank statements from all accounts (typically three months)
• Tax returns and Notice of Assessment
• Employment contract or letter from employer
• Details of existing debts and credit commitments
• Identification documents
• Asset statements (superannuation, investments, vehicles)

Self-employed applicants may need additional documentation, including business financial statements and accountant declarations.

Understanding Key Factors in Pre-approval

Borrowing Capacity Assessment

Lenders calculate your borrowing capacity using various factors including your income, existing debts, living expenses, and the proposed loan to value ratio (LVR). They also consider your employment stability and credit history.

Interest Rate Considerations

During pre-approval, lenders will outline available interest rate options, including variable interest rate and fixed interest rate products. Understanding these options helps you make informed decisions about your home loan structure.

Lenders Mortgage Insurance (LMI)

If your deposit is less than 20% of the property value, you'll likely need to pay lenders mortgage insurance. This cost should be factored into your overall budget when calculating home loan repayments.

The Pre-approval Process

Step 1: Initial Assessment

A mortgage broker will review your financial situation and discuss your home loan options. This includes assessing your deposit, income stability, and preferred loan features such as offset account facilities.

Step 2: Lender Selection

With access to home loan options from banks and lenders across Australia, your broker can identify the most suitable products based on your circumstances. This includes comparing home loan rates, fees, and features.

Step 3: Application Submission

Your home loan application is submitted with all required documentation. The streamlined application process typically takes between 3-10 business days for most lenders.

Step 4: Credit Assessment

Lenders conduct thorough assessments including credit checks, income verification, and expense analysis. They may request additional information during this stage.

Step 5: Pre-approval Issued

Once approved, you'll receive a conditional approval letter outlining your loan amount, interest rate, and any conditions that must be met.

Preparing for Pre-approval Success

Strengthen Your Financial Position

Before applying for a home loan, review your financial situation thoroughly. Pay down existing debts, maintain consistent savings patterns, and avoid taking on new credit commitments.

Consider Additional Costs

Remember that buying a home involves costs beyond the purchase price, including stamp duty, legal fees, building inspections, and ongoing maintenance. Factor these into your budget calculations.

Property Market Considerations

Understanding current property market conditions can help you set realistic expectations for your purchase timeline and budget requirements.

Interest Rate Options Explained

Variable Home Loan Rates

Variable interest rates can fluctuate with market conditions. These loans often offer features like offset accounts and allow extra repayments without penalties.

Fixed Interest Rate Home Loans

Fixed interest rate home loans provide certainty with locked rates for specified periods, typically one to five years. These products offer predictable repayments but may have fewer features.

Calculating Home Loan Repayments

Use online calculators to estimate repayments based on different loan amounts and home loan interest rates. Consider both principal and interest repayments and factor in any interest rate discounts you may qualify for.
